The Company:
Optitex (www.optitex.com) is the leading global provider of integrated 2D/3D product development software solutions for the fashion, apparel, transportation interiors, and furniture markets. With three decades of experience and over 30,000 installations worldwide, Optitex delivers a comprehensive range of tools that assist and accelerate the product development process, reducing returns, enhancing sustainability, and boosting operational excellence.
Optitex is a portfolio company of FOG Software Group (www.fogsoftwaregroup.com), which is a subsidiary of Constellation Software Inc. (www.csisoftware.com). Constellation is listed on the Toronto Stock Exchange and is a conglomerate of vertical market software companies. Constellation has completed over 800 acquisitions since inception in 1995 and is all about strengthening these businesses and enabling them to grow – whether through organic measures such as new initiatives and product development, day-to-day business, or through acquisitions. As is Constellation’s unique model, FOG Software buys and holds companies forever, which requires continuous investment in our businesses - their products, brands, and people - and a long-term horizon for strategic decisions.
